The Production Manager will oversee all plant production, materials, equipment, and tools to ensure efficiency is maintained and projects remain on schedule for the assembly of a wide range of industrial blower and compressor packages. The Production Manager will directly oversee floor personnel to ensure work is properly delegated and executed, maintain the ability to prioritize projects, and ensure they remain on schedule. In addition, they will ensure safety problems that arise are addressed and all required paperwork is completed. They will ensure shop equipment is being tracked, maintained, and available as required, and assist with resolving assembly issues as required. The Production Manager will work closely with the Director of Operations and Project Managers in the planning and communication of daily plant activities.

- Manage and supervise the production and warehouse material handling personnel.
- Lead the direction of production and assembly activities.
- Lead the planning and coordination of production jobs and projects.
- Maintain and updates manufacturing equipment information, including maintenance & repair logs.
- Participates in plant safety, health, and environmental programs.
- Ability to read and interpret documents and drawings.
- Assist with the overall total cost estimate for the work to be performed: labor, material, and outside services.
- Manage the status of work control and backlog for work order submission to work order completion.
- Actively participate in scheduling meetings with operation partners to finalize priority of work orders, optimum downtime windows, and necessary lead times.
- Issue scheduled work orders with job plan packets.
- Communicate all health and safety concerns to employees and management.
- Make constructive suggestions pertaining to plant performance.
